An evolution Pokemon card is one that represents the evolved form of a Pokemon. You know, like when your cute little Charmander turns into a fearsome Charizard. In the Pokemon TCG, you place the evolution card on top of the basic Pokemon card during play to 'evolve' it, making it stronger and giving it new abilities to crush your opponent with!
